Comprehending Foggy Windows
What Causes Foggy Windows?
Foggy windows are a common issue in homes, especially those with double or triple-pane glass. The main reasons for foggy windows consist of:
Cause
Description
Seal Failure
With time, the seals around window panes can weaken, allowing moisture to go into.
Temperature Fluctuations
Quick changes in temperature level can cause condensation to form within the panes.
Humidity
High indoor humidity levels can lead to condensation on and in between windows.
Poor Insulation
Inadequate insulation might lead to temperature level distinctions that add to fogginess.
Restoration Options for Foggy Windows
Once a window has ended up being foggy, homeowners have various choices for restoration. The choice largely depends on the severity of the fog and the condition of the window.
1. Do it yourself Defogging
For small misting problems, a DIY approach may be enough. Here are some popular DIY methods:
- Hair Dryer Method: Use a hairdryer to warm the foggy window. This might help vaporize some moisture.
- Dehumidifier: Running a dehumidifier in the space can lower humidity and help in clearing foggy windows.
- Desiccants: Place moisture-absorbing products (like silica gel or sodium bicarbonate) near the window to assist absorb excess humidity.
2. Professional Cleaning
If DIY methods do not yield the wanted outcomes, consider employing a professional window cleansing service. Experienced experts may utilize specific devices and techniques to get rid of moisture and restore clearness without damaging the window.
3. Seal Repair or Replacement
When the seal of a double or triple-pane window fails, it might be necessary to repair or replace it. Here are 2 main choices homeowners can consider:
- Window Seal Repair: Some companies provide repair services that include resealing the window, usually utilizing specialized materials designed to create a durable seal.
- Window Replacement: If the damage is substantial or the window is old, replacing the whole window may be the very best and most economical long-term solution.
4. Foggy Window Kits
Numerous industrial foggy window restoration packages are offered. These sets usually contain products to create a temporary seal or soak up moisture. Always follow the producer's instructions for best results.

Benefits of Addressing Foggy Windows
Disregarding foggy windows can cause numerous issues, including:
- Reduced Aesthetic Appeal: Foggy windows reduce the visual beauty of a home both inside and out.
- Decreased Energy Efficiency: Foggy windows may show bad insulation, causing increased energy expenses as heating/cooling systems work more difficult to preserve temperature.
- Potential Structural Issues: Prolonged moisture direct exposure can lead to mold development and wear and tear of window frames and surrounding products.
- Lower Property Value: A home with foggy windows may not offer well, as possible buyers may view it as inadequately kept.
